Belgium 0-0 Iran as Zlatan Ibrahimovic mocks critics

🇧🇪 4 hours ago
The Belgium national team, known as the Red Devils, played a goalless draw against Iran in Los Angeles, marking their second equal result of the World Cup, while foreign media reacted sharply and Zlatan Ibrahimovic fell asleep, remarking, “Als ze denken zich te kwalificeren door de namen op hun shirt, vergissen ze zich”. Belgium generated numerous scoring opportunities but failed to find the net. Iran also held a clean sheet, resulting in a 0‑0 stalemate. Across Europe, journalists watched the game with furrowed eyebrows. Their criticism focused on Belgium’s inability to convert chances. The fixture was staged at a stadium in Los Angeles. The venue hosted the group‑stage encounter between the two nations. This draw represented Belgium’s second equal result of the current World Cup. Earlier in the tournament they also shared points with another opponent. During the match, Zlatan Ibrahimovic fell asleep and later voiced his frustration. He said: “Als ze denken zich te kwalificeren door de namen op hun shirt, vergissen ze zich”.
